Solan, July 20:
A rare weather event unfolded in the Kandaghat area of Solan district on Saturday afternoon, resembling a typical winter morning rather than a monsoon day. Dense fog enveloped the region, turning broad daylight into near darkness and drastically reducing visibility along National Highway-5 (Chandigarh–Shimla highway).

Light drizzles had been falling since morning, but around 1 PM, visibility dropped to nearly zero near “Meghdoot,” a Himachal Pradesh Tourism hotel located about 8 km from Kandaghat toward Shimla. The sudden onset of thick fog caught commuters off guard and caused major difficulties for motorists. Even in the middle of the day, drivers were forced to switch on their headlights to navigate safely and avoid accidents.

Local residents noted that while fog during monsoon is not uncommon in hilly areas, the density of the fog on this occasion made the scene appear more like a chilly winter morning. Authorities and traffic police have urged motorists to exercise caution and drive slowly under such conditions to ensure safety.
